Dariyapur Population - Munger, Bihar

Dariyapur is a large village located in Kharagpur Block of Munger district, Bihar with total 802 families residing. The Dariyapur village has population of 3755 of which 1992 are males while 1763 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Dariyapur village population of children with age 0-6 is 606 which makes up 16.14 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dariyapur village is 885 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Dariyapur as per census is 804,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Dariyapur village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Dariyapur village was 60.08 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Dariyapur Male literacy stands at 66.79 % while female literacy rate was 52.65 %.

Caste Factor

In Dariyapur village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 40.05 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 10.68 % of total population in Dariyapur village.

Work Profile

In Dariyapur village out of total population, 1178 were engaged in work activities. 54.84 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 45.16 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1178 workers engaged in Main Work, 198 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 266 were Agricultural labourer.
